Musicologist Richard Dumbrill now uses the word a lot more categorically to debate devices that existed millennia ahead of the time youtube period "lute" was coined.[26] Dumbrill documented much more than 3000 many years of iconographic evidence for that lutes in Mesopotamia, in his reserve The Archaeomusicology of The traditional Near East. Based on Dumbrill, the lute loved ones provided instruments in Mesopotamia just before 3000 BC.[27] He factors into a cylinder seal as proof; courting from c. 3100 BC or previously (now while in the possession of your British Museum); the seal depicts on one facet what is considered a girl actively playing a adhere "lute".
The 1st evidence of devices we can really say are ouds are during the art of your Sassanid era of Iran, the final Iranian empire ahead of the rise of Islam, from CE 224 to 651.
This distinction isn't based entirely on geography; the Arabic oud is uncovered not simply while in the Arabian Peninsula but all through the Arab earth.[50] Turkish ouds have already been played by Anatolian Greeks, where by These are named outi, and in other locations during the Mediterranean.

Permalink Hi, superior write-up! I planned to touch upon the Mesopotamian image on the ‘a little something or other’ that the British Museum claims is often a lute. I’ve been executing my PhD on lengthy neck lutes and put in my initially year studying the ancient Mesopotamian photographs, and I’m confident that that figure just isn't enjoying a lute of any kind! The entire cylinder seal depicts a royal barge called a maghur that kings of some time would use to travel from metropolis to metropolis in their domains through the canals that delivered irrigation and served as ‘roadways’–maintaining these was one of several king’s primary duties in that fairly arid region. The seal shows fairly common iconography for that topic: there’s a standing man in front, a punter, who uses his lengthy pole to push the barge along and shift objects outside of just how. In the center there’s a bull by using a square throne on its back again–a image on the king himself who normally had the title ‘Wild Bull on the Mountain’, and an actual bull who would be the sacrifice at temple rites in town the king was touring to.
